{"id":"https://openalex.org/W2171511580","doi":"https://doi.org/10.1109/ase.2002.1115011","title":"Enabling iterative software architecture derivation using early non-functional property evaluation","display_name":"Enabling iterative software architecture derivation using early non-functional property evaluation","publication_year":2002,"publication_date":"2002-01-01","ids":{"openalex":"https://openalex.org/W2171511580","doi":"https://doi.org/10.1109/ase.2002.1115011","mag":"2171511580"},"language":"en","primary_location":{"id":"doi:10.1109/ase.2002.1115011","is_oa":false,"landing_page_url":"https://doi.org/10.1109/ase.2002.1115011","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ings 17th IEEE International Conference on Automated Software Engineering,","raw_type":"proceedings-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":false,"oa_status":"closed","oa_url":null,"any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5037778963","display_name":"K. Suzanne Barber","orcid":"https://orcid.org/0000-0003-2906-6583"},"institutions":[{"id":"https://openalex.org/I86519309","display_name":"The University of Texas at Austin","ror":"https://ror.org/00hj54h04","country_code":"US","type":"education","lineage":["https://openalex.org/I86519309"]}],"countries":["US"],"is_corresponding":true,"raw_author_name":"K.S. Barber","raw_affiliation_strings":["Lab. for Intelligent Processes & Syst. Electr. & Comput. Eng., Texas Univ., Austin, TX, USA","Laboratory for Intelligent Processes and Systems Electrical and Computer Engineering, University of Technology, Austin, TX, USA"],"affiliations":[{"raw_affiliation_string":"Lab. for Intelligent Processes & Syst. Electr. & Comput. Eng., Texas Univ., Austin, TX, USA","institution_ids":["https://openalex.org/I86519309"]},{"raw_affiliation_string":"Laboratory for Intelligent Processes and Systems Electrical and Computer Engineering, University of Technology, Austin, TX, USA","institution_ids":["https://openalex.org/I86519309"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5111428201","display_name":"T. Graser","orcid":null},"institutions":[{"id":"https://openalex.org/I86519309","display_name":"The University of Texas at Austin","ror":"https://ror.org/00hj54h04","country_code":"US","type":"education","lineage":["https://openalex.org/I86519309"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"T. Graser","raw_affiliation_strings":["Lab. for Intelligent Processes & Syst. Electr. & Comput. Eng., Texas Univ., Austin, TX, USA","Laboratory for Intelligent Processes and Systems Electrical and Computer Engineering, University of Technology, Austin, TX, USA"],"affiliations":[{"raw_affiliation_string":"Lab. for Intelligent Processes & Syst. Electr. & Comput. Eng., Texas Univ., Austin, TX, USA","institution_ids":["https://openalex.org/I86519309"]},{"raw_affiliation_string":"Laboratory for Intelligent Processes and Systems Electrical and Computer Engineering, University of Technology, Austin, TX, USA","institution_ids":["https://openalex.org/I86519309"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5113591675","display_name":"Jim Holt","orcid":null},"institutions":[{"id":"https://openalex.org/I86519309","display_name":"The University of Texas at Austin","ror":"https://ror.org/00hj54h04","country_code":"US","type":"education","lineage":["https://openalex.org/I86519309"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"J. Holt","raw_affiliation_strings":["Lab. for Intelligent Processes & Syst. Electr. & Comput. Eng., Texas Univ., Austin, TX, USA","Laboratory for Intelligent Processes and Systems Electrical and Computer Engineering, University of Technology, Austin, TX, USA"],"affiliations":[{"raw_affiliation_string":"Lab. for Intelligent Processes & Syst. Electr. & Comput. Eng., Texas Univ., Austin, TX, USA","institution_ids":["https://openalex.org/I86519309"]},{"raw_affiliation_string":"Laboratory for Intelligent Processes and Systems Electrical and Computer Engineering, University of Technology, Austin, TX, USA","institution_ids":["https://openalex.org/I86519309"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":3,"corresponding_author_ids":["https://openalex.org/A5037778963"],"corresponding_institution_ids":["https://openalex.org/I86519309"],"apc_list":null,"apc_paid":null,"fwci":1.3266,"has_fulltext":false,"cited_by_count":20,"citation_normalized_percentile":{"value":0.88329441,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":{"min":89,"max":98},"biblio":{"volume":null,"issue":null,"first_page":"172","last_page":"182"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T10260","display_name":"Software Engineering Research","score":0.9998999834060669,"subfield":{"id":"https://openalex.org/subfields/1710","display_name":"Information Systems"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10260","display_name":"Software Engineering Research","score":0.9998999834060669,"subfield":{"id":"https://openalex.org/subfields/1710","display_name":"Information Systems"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10639","display_name":"Advanced Software Engineering Methodologies","score":0.9998999834060669,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T12127","display_name":"Software System Performance and Reliability","score":0.9994999766349792,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.7608823776245117},{"id":"https://openalex.org/keywords/maintainability","display_name":"Maintainability","score":0.6863160133361816},{"id":"https://openalex.org/keywords/reference-architecture","display_name":"Reference architecture","score":0.6558101773262024},{"id":"https://openalex.org/keywords/suite","display_name":"Suite","score":0.5593532919883728},{"id":"https://openalex.org/keywords/architecture","display_name":"Architecture","score":0.5539108514785767},{"id":"https://openalex.org/keywords/software-architecture","display_name":"Software architecture","score":0.5527580380439758},{"id":"https://openalex.org/keywords/software-engineering","display_name":"Software engineering","score":0.514987051486969},{"id":"https://openalex.org/keywords/reusability","display_name":"Reusability","score":0.4972255527973175},{"id":"https://openalex.org/keywords/heuristics","display_name":"Heuristics","score":0.4942357838153839},{"id":"https://openalex.org/keywords/software-architecture-description","display_name":"Software architecture description","score":0.4724462628364563},{"id":"https://openalex.org/keywords/domain","display_name":"Domain (mathematical analysis)","score":0.4700177013874054},{"id":"https://openalex.org/keywords/iterative-and-incremental-development","display_name":"Iterative and incremental development","score":0.46357184648513794},{"id":"https://openalex.org/keywords/iterative-design","display_name":"Iterative design","score":0.4441835582256317},{"id":"https://openalex.org/keywords/property","display_name":"Property (philosophy)","score":0.43562859296798706},{"id":"https://openalex.org/keywords/computer-architecture","display_name":"Computer architecture","score":0.40349823236465454},{"id":"https://openalex.org/keywords/software","display_name":"Software","score":0.38273876905441284},{"id":"https://openalex.org/keywords/distributed-computing","display_name":"Distributed computing","score":0.33279943466186523},{"id":"https://openalex.org/keywords/programming-language","display_name":"Programming language","score":0.21035510301589966},{"id":"https://openalex.org/keywords/scheduling","display_name":"Scheduling (production processes)","score":0.14878705143928528},{"id":"https://openalex.org/keywords/engineering","display_name":"Engineering","score":0.12590649724006653},{"id":"https://openalex.org/keywords/operating-system","display_name":"Operating system","score":0.11148223280906677}],"concepts":[{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.7608823776245117},{"id":"https://openalex.org/C160713754","wikidata":"https://www.wikidata.org/wiki/Q1389965","display_name":"Maintainability","level":2,"score":0.6863160133361816},{"id":"https://openalex.org/C55356503","wikidata":"https://www.wikidata.org/wiki/Q2136675","display_name":"Reference architecture","level":4,"score":0.6558101773262024},{"id":"https://openalex.org/C79581498","wikidata":"https://www.wikidata.org/wiki/Q1367530","display_name":"Suite","level":2,"score":0.5593532919883728},{"id":"https://openalex.org/C123657996","wikidata":"https://www.wikidata.org/wiki/Q12271","display_name":"Architecture","level":2,"score":0.5539108514785767},{"id":"https://openalex.org/C35869016","wikidata":"https://www.wikidata.org/wiki/Q846636","display_name":"Software architecture","level":3,"score":0.5527580380439758},{"id":"https://openalex.org/C115903868","wikidata":"https://www.wikidata.org/wiki/Q80993","display_name":"Software engineering","level":1,"score":0.514987051486969},{"id":"https://openalex.org/C137981799","wikidata":"https://www.wikidata.org/wiki/Q1369184","display_name":"Reusability","level":3,"score":0.4972255527973175},{"id":"https://openalex.org/C127705205","wikidata":"https://www.wikidata.org/wiki/Q5748245","display_name":"Heuristics","level":2,"score":0.4942357838153839},{"id":"https://openalex.org/C73219336","wikidata":"https://www.wikidata.org/wiki/Q7554254","display_name":"Software architecture description","level":5,"score":0.4724462628364563},{"id":"https://openalex.org/C36503486","wikidata":"https://www.wikidata.org/wiki/Q11235244","display_name":"Domain (mathematical analysis)","level":2,"score":0.4700177013874054},{"id":"https://openalex.org/C143587482","wikidata":"https://www.wikidata.org/wiki/Q1543216","display_name":"Iterative and incremental development","level":2,"score":0.46357184648513794},{"id":"https://openalex.org/C106246047","wikidata":"https://www.wikidata.org/wiki/Q4928435","display_name":"Iterative design","level":3,"score":0.4441835582256317},{"id":"https://openalex.org/C189950617","wikidata":"https://www.wikidata.org/wiki/Q937228","display_name":"Property (philosophy)","level":2,"score":0.43562859296798706},{"id":"https://openalex.org/C118524514","wikidata":"https://www.wikidata.org/wiki/Q173212","display_name":"Computer architecture","level":1,"score":0.40349823236465454},{"id":"https://openalex.org/C2777904410","wikidata":"https://www.wikidata.org/wiki/Q7397","display_name":"Software","level":2,"score":0.38273876905441284},{"id":"https://openalex.org/C120314980","wikidata":"https://www.wikidata.org/wiki/Q180634","display_name":"Distributed computing","level":1,"score":0.33279943466186523},{"id":"https://openalex.org/C199360897","wikidata":"https://www.wikidata.org/wiki/Q9143","display_name":"Programming language","level":1,"score":0.21035510301589966},{"id":"https://openalex.org/C206729178","wikidata":"https://www.wikidata.org/wiki/Q2271896","display_name":"Scheduling (production processes)","level":2,"score":0.14878705143928528},{"id":"https://openalex.org/C127413603","wikidata":"https://www.wikidata.org/wiki/Q11023","display_name":"Engineering","level":0,"score":0.12590649724006653},{"id":"https://openalex.org/C111919701","wikidata":"https://www.wikidata.org/wiki/Q9135","display_name":"Operating system","level":1,"score":0.11148223280906677},{"id":"https://openalex.org/C138885662","wikidata":"https://www.wikidata.org/wiki/Q5891","display_name":"Philosophy","level":0,"score":0.0},{"id":"https://openalex.org/C134306372","wikidata":"https://www.wikidata.org/wiki/Q7754","display_name":"Mathematical analysis","level":1,"score":0.0},{"id":"https://openalex.org/C111472728","wikidata":"https://www.wikidata.org/wiki/Q9471","display_name":"Epistemology","level":1,"score":0.0},{"id":"https://openalex.org/C33923547","wikidata":"https://www.wikidata.org/wiki/Q395","display_name":"Mathematics","level":0,"score":0.0},{"id":"https://openalex.org/C95457728","wikidata":"https://www.wikidata.org/wiki/Q309","display_name":"History","level":0,"score":0.0},{"id":"https://openalex.org/C21547014","wikidata":"https://www.wikidata.org/wiki/Q1423657","display_name":"Operations management","level":1,"score":0.0},{"id":"https://openalex.org/C142362112","wikidata":"https://www.wikidata.org/wiki/Q735","display_name":"Art","level":0,"score":0.0},{"id":"https://openalex.org/C166957645","wikidata":"https://www.wikidata.org/wiki/Q23498","display_name":"Archaeology","level":1,"score":0.0},{"id":"https://openalex.org/C153349607","wikidata":"https://www.wikidata.org/wiki/Q36649","display_name":"Visual arts","level":1,"score":0.0}],"mesh":[],"locations_count":1,"locations":[{"id":"doi:10.1109/ase.2002.1115011","is_oa":false,"landing_page_url":"https://doi.org/10.1109/ase.2002.1115011","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ings 17th IEEE International Conference on Automated Software Engineering,","raw_type":"proceedings-article"}],"best_oa_location":null,"sustainable_development_goals":[{"display_name":"Industry, innovation and infrastructure","score":0.47999998927116394,"id":"https://metadata.un.org/sdg/9"}],"awards":[],"funders":[{"id":"https://openalex.org/F4320307065","display_name":"Schlumberger Foundation","ror":"https://ror.org/03daw3m97"},{"id":"https://openalex.org/F4320308138","display_name":"Texas Higher Education Coordinating Board","ror":"https://ror.org/05as1qb59"}],"has_content":{"pdf":false,"grobid_xml":false},"content_urls":null,"referenced_works_count":23,"referenced_works":["https://openalex.org/W74563322","https://openalex.org/W239822304","https://openalex.org/W1511637839","https://openalex.org/W1619579880","https://openalex.org/W2072640987","https://openalex.org/W2099993644","https://openalex.org/W2101105780","https://openalex.org/W2103891574","https://openalex.org/W2108225775","https://openalex.org/W2112527263","https://openalex.org/W2128114188","https://openalex.org/W2143662842","https://openalex.org/W2152317203","https://openalex.org/W2158864412","https://openalex.org/W2164070935","https://openalex.org/W2413760220","https://openalex.org/W4239849402","https://openalex.org/W4248507946","https://openalex.org/W6603010288","https://openalex.org/W6609359544","https://openalex.org/W6636448357","https://openalex.org/W6682700007","https://openalex.org/W6715406364"],"related_works":["https://openalex.org/W2376244192","https://openalex.org/W2053107757","https://openalex.org/W2017266164","https://openalex.org/W2354797847","https://openalex.org/W2124684568","https://openalex.org/W2108340160","https://openalex.org/W2499568239","https://openalex.org/W2976480616","https://openalex.org/W2096603828","https://openalex.org/W174255016"],"abstract_inverted_index":{"The":[0,76,189],"structure":[1],"of":[2,47,53,61,79,90,102,169,194],"a":[3,45,59,88,127,157,175,180],"software":[4],"architecture":[5,32,68,116,119,135,182],"strongly":[6],"influences":[7],"the":[8,51,133,166],"architecture's":[9],"ability":[10],"to":[11,66,113,173,204],"prescribe":[12],"systems":[13],"satisfying":[14],"functional":[15,18],"requirements,":[16,19],"non":[17],"and":[20,27,37,63,85,110,118,131,152,161,187,197,201,208,224],"overall":[21],"qualities":[22],"such":[23],"as":[24,215,217],"maintainability,":[25],"reusability,":[26],"performance.":[28],"Achieving":[29],"an":[30,34,170],"acceptable":[31],"requires":[33],"iterative":[35,115,206],"derivation":[36,69,84,117,124,207],"evaluation":[38,86,91,140,149,193],"process":[39],"that":[40],"allows":[41],"refinement":[42,214],"based":[43,141],"on":[44,142],"series":[46],"tradeoffs.":[48],"Researchers":[49],"at":[50,55],"University":[52],"Texas":[54],"Austin":[56],"are":[57],"developing":[58],"suite":[60],"processes":[62],"supporting":[64],"tools":[65,105],"guide":[67],"from":[70],"requirements":[71],"acquisition":[72],"through":[73],"system":[74],"design.":[75],"various":[77],"types":[78],"decisions":[80,220],"needed":[81],"for":[82,99],"concurrent":[83],"demand":[87],"synthesis":[89],"techniques,":[92],"because":[93],"no":[94],"single":[95],"technique":[96],"is":[97],"suitable":[98],"all":[100],"concerns":[101],"interest.":[103],"Two":[104],"in":[106,165],"this":[107],"suite,":[108],"RARE":[109,122,160,202],"ARCADE,":[111],"cooperate":[112,203],"enable":[114,205],"property":[120,139,148],"evaluation.":[121,209],"guides":[123],"by":[125,136],"employing":[126],"heuristics":[128],"knowledge":[129],"base,":[130],"evaluates":[132],"resulting":[134],"applying":[137],"static":[138],"structural":[143],"metrics.":[144],"ARCADE":[145,162,200],"provides":[146],"dynamic":[147],"leveraging":[150],"simulation":[151],"model-checking.":[153],"This":[154],"paper":[155],"presents":[156],"study":[158],"whereby":[159],"were":[163],"employed":[164],"early":[167,192],"stages":[168],"industrial":[171],"project":[172],"derive":[174],"Domain":[176],"Reference":[177],"Architecture":[178],"(DRA),":[179],"high-level":[181],"capturing":[183],"domain":[184],"functionality,":[185],"data,":[186],"timing.":[188],"discussion":[190],"emphasizes":[191],"performance":[195],"qualities,":[196],"illustrates":[198],"how":[199],"These":[210],"evaluations":[211],"influenced":[212],"DRA":[213],"well":[216],"subsequent":[218],"design":[219],"involving":[221],"application":[222],"implementation":[223],"computing":[225],"platform":[226],"selection.":[227]},"counts_by_year":[{"year":2020,"cited_by_count":1},{"year":2016,"cited_by_count":1},{"year":2015,"cited_by_count":1},{"year":2014,"cited_by_count":1},{"year":2013,"cited_by_count":1},{"year":2012,"cited_by_count":5}],"updated_date":"2025-11-06T03:46:38.306776","created_date":"2025-10-10T00:00:00"}
